Recent investments

Seed
£2.3M

The conversational platform formerly known as Dazzle has raised its first seed financing from corporate and government backers.

"The response to our tech and proposition has been incredible. We’ve always believed that we had a transformational product with HelloDone so to have such strong backing gives us even more confidence. Businesses have to start meeting consumers where they are, on WhatsApp, on Facebook Messenger, on Alexa and all the other messaging channels. HelloDone is scaling it’s conversational platform using natural language processing to enable businesses in the Transport, Home Delivery and Utilities space to solve customer needs via messaging channels and voice assistants. It’s an amazing platform and the funding will enable us to capture the growth potential we believe exists."
— Ed Hodges, CEO
